Ingredients You’ll Need
- For the crust:
- 1 ½ cups Oreo cookie crumbs: The base of our cheesecake, providing a crunchy texture and a chocolatey flavor.
- ½ cup unsalted butter, melted: Binds the crumbs together and adds richness to the crust.
- For the filling:
- 16 ounces cream cheese, softened: The star of the show, giving the cheesecake its creamy texture and tanginess.
- 1 cup powdered sugar: Adds sweetness while ensuring a smooth finish.
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ract: Enhances the overall flavor profile of the cheesecake.
- 1 cup whipped cream: Incorporates air for a light and fluffy texture.
- 1 cup cherries, pitted and chopped: Provides the essential tartness and freshness.
- ½ cup chocolate chips: Adds richness and delightful bursts of chocolate in every bite.

Step-by-Step Instructions
- Prepare the crust: In a bowl, mix the Oreo cookie crumbs and melted butter until well combined. Press this mixture firmly into the bottom of a 9-inch springform pan to form an even layer. Refrigerate while you make the filling.
- Make the filling: In a mixing bowl, beat the softened cream cheese until smooth. Gradually add the powdered sugar and vanilla extract, mixing until fluffy.
- Add the whipped cream: Gently fold in the whipped cream until fully combined and light.
- Incorporate cherries and chocolate chips: Carefully fold in the chopped cherries and chocolate chips, ensuring they’re evenly distributed throughout the filling.
- Assemble the cheesecake: Pour the filling into the prepared crust and smooth the top with a spatula. Refrigerate for at least 4 hours or overnight until set.
- Serve: When ready to serve, run a knife around the edges of the cheesecake and release the springform pan. Top with additional cherries or whipped cream garnish as desired.
Recipe Variations
This recipe is wonderfully adaptable. For a tropical flair, consider swapping the cherries for crushed pineapple or mango. Alternatively, you can use different cookies for the crust, such as chocolate graham crackers or even gluten-free options. If you’re into layered desserts, create a layered cheesecake by adding additional fillings, like a chocolate ganache or fruit pureé between layers.
Serving and Storage Tips
Serve the cheesecake cold, cut into slices or wedges for easier handling. It’s best enjoyed within the first few days after making it, but you can store leftovers in the refrigerator for up to five days. Cover the cheesecake tightly or place it in an airtight container to maintain its freshness. For longer storage, consider freezing the cheesecake, wrapping it well in plastic wrap and aluminum foil; it can last up to three months in the freezer.
Helpful Tips
To make the best cheesecake, ensure your cream cheese is at room temperature before mixing. This helps achieve a smooth, lump-free mixture. Also, when folding in the whipped cream, be gentle to maintain the lightness and texture. For a unique twist, consider using flavored cream cheese, like strawberry or lemon, to add a different layer of flavor to your cheesecake.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use low-fat cream cheese?
Yes, you can use low-fat cream cheese; however, it may alter the final texture and creaminess of your cheesecake. Make sure it’s softened to room temperature for easier mixing.
How long does it take for the cheesecake to set?
The cheesecake needs to chill in the refrigerator for at least 4 hours. However, for the best flavor and texture, consider leaving it overnight to fully set.
Can I freeze the cheesecake?
Yes, this cheesecake freezes well! Just wrap it tightly in plastic wrap and then in aluminum foil. When ready to eat, thaw it in the refrigerator overnight.
Can I use different fruits?
Absolutely! This recipe is versatile, and you can use almost any type of fruit. Strawberries, blueberries, or raspberries work exceptionally well in place of cherries.
